What is an H-1B Visa and Who Can Apply?

The H1B visa is a work visa granted to Turkish professionals who want to work in specialized professions in the US. This visa is designed specifically for those specializing in technology, engineering, finance, and healthcare. So, who is eligible to apply for an H1B visa?

  • Education Requirement: Those who have at least a bachelor's degree or equivalent education and experience can apply.
  • Job Offer: You cannot apply for this visa on your own, so you must have a job offer from an American company.
  • Fields Requiring Expertise: This visa is not open to applicants from every sector, and you must be an expert in the fields determined by the USCIS.

H-1B Visa Fees

H-1B visa fees are a key factor in the application process. To avoid financial difficulties, it's best to prepare for these costs in advance. However, the basic costs of an H-1B visa are as follows:

  • Application Fee: $460 (Basic fee for H1B application)
  • Anti-Fraud Fee: $500 (Anti-fraud fee)
  • Priority Service Fee (Optional): $2,500 (Ensures the application is finalized within 15 days)
  • Training and Labor Fee: $750 – $1,500 (Varies depending on the size of the employer. Your employer also pays this.)

How Many Days Does It Take to Get an H-1B Visa?

A particularly eagerly anticipated process begins after the application is submitted. During this process, many experts begin asking, "How long does it take to obtain an H1B visa?" after completing their preparations. This exciting wait typically goes something like this:

  • Standard Timeframe: Applications are generally finalized within 3 to 6 months.
  • Expedited Time: By paying an extra fee (priority service), you can get results within 15 days.
  • Request for Additional Documents: If USCIS requests additional information, the process may take longer.
